How To Remove Windows Defender?

Open Windows Security

Go to Virus & threat protection

Select Manage settings

Turn off Real-time protection

Go to App & browser control

Turn off Reputation-based protection settings

Open Group Policy Editor

Navigate to Computer Configuration > Administrative Templates > Windows Components > Microsoft Defender Antivirus

Open Turn off Microsoft Defender Antivirus

Set it to Enabled

Restart the computer

Open Registry Editor

Navigate to H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INESOFTWAREPoliciesMicrosoftWindows Defender

Create or set DisableAntiSpyware to 1

Restart the computer

Use a third-party antivirus if you want Defender to stay disabled

Re-enable protection later by reversing the changes
